People-Centred Care Practices at Care Medical Imaging

At our imaging center, we prioritize people-centred care by ensuring that every patient feels respected, informed, and supported throughout their diagnostic journey. Key practices include:

  1. Clear Communication: Technologists and staff explain each procedure in simple, reassuring language, addressing questions and reducing anxiety before imaging begins.
  2. Respect & Dignity: Patients are treated with sensitivity and professionalism, with attention to privacy during preparation, positioning, and examination.
  3. Individualized Care: We adapt our approach based on each patient’s needs - including mobility limitations, language barriers, cultural considerations, and emotional stress.
  4. Efficient Workflow to Reduce Wait Times: Scheduling, registration, and patient flow processes are optimized to minimize delays and improve the overall experience.
  5. Safety & Comfort Focus: Technologists continuously monitor patient comfort during imaging, adjust positioning, and ensure adherence to radiation-safety standards.
  6. Collaborative Team Approach: Radiologists, technologists and administrative staff communicate effectively to coordinate care and ensure accurate, timely results.
  7. Patient Feedback & Continuous Improvement: The center actively collects patient feedback and uses it to enhance service quality and patient satisfaction.
  8. Supportive Environment: We create a calm, welcoming environment through respectful interaction, clear guidance, and compassionate staff presence.

Our imaging center is committed to providing high-quality, people-centred care by ensuring that every patient receives respectful, safe, and timely diagnostic services.

Examinations Offered

We provide a full range of diagnostic imaging services, including:

  • X-ray (general radiography)
  • Ultrasound (abdominal, pelvic, obstetric, vascular, small parts)
  • Thyroid FNA
  • Sonohysteroraphy
  • Bone Mineral Density (BMD)
  • Echocardiography
  • Holter Monitoring

How to Access Services

  We make access simple and patient-friendly:

  • Referral-based services: Most imaging requires a requisition from a family doctor or specialist.
  • Walk-in services: X-ray and Holter monitoring are available on a walk-in basis with a valid requisition.
  • Appointment-based services: Ultrasound, BMD, Echocardiogram, FNA and Sonohysterograms require pre-scheduled appointments.
  • Multiple booking options:
    • Phone booking through our reception team
    • Online appointment request form
    • Physician e-fax referral system

Patients receive clear instructions on preparation, arrival time, and expected duration of the exam.

When to Expect Results

  We prioritize timely reporting to reduce patient anxiety:

  • Routine exams (X-ray, Ultrasound): Results are typically sent to the referring physician within 3-4 Days
  • Urgent or abnormal findings: Radiologist contacts the referring physician immediately
  • Biopsy & FNA results: Usually available within 3-7 business days
  • Cardiac tests (Holter, Echo): Reports completed within 3-5 business days

Patients are informed that results are communicated directly to their referring healthcare provider, who will discuss the findings and next steps.
